Ask for License and Insurance 

A great tip for finding the best long-distance movers is to check for a license and insurance policy. You want to work with a company that has the proper license to operate legally and the insurance to protect your belongings. Make sure you see proof of the license and insurance before hiring any company. 

Confirm the Company’s Service Area 

Before hiring long-distance furniture movers, check the company’s service area. You want to make sure the company services the area around your old home as well as your new home. Check the service area before signing on the dotted line. 

Ask About Their Services

Before choosing a removalist company, ask what services they provide. If you are looking for a company that can handle specialty items or requests, it’s essential to make sure the companies you are considering offer what you need. You can check their services by looking online or speaking to a representative. 

Check the Company’s Reputation

Another tip for hiring a good long-distance moving company is to research their reputation. Read ratings, reviews, and testimonials. You can also check the company’s BBB page to ensure they have a great reputation with previous customers. 

Get Several Estimates

Before hiring Removalists, make sure to get estimates from several companies. Compare the prices and everything the price includes. Look for an affordable option that provides exactly what you need. 

Look for Signs of a Scam 

Unfortunately, there are many cheap long-distance movers that seem legitimate but are actually scams. Some of the red flags to look for are asking for a deposit, showing up in rented vehicles, or expecting you to sign incomplete or blank documents. If you notice any of these red flags, move on to another company.
